When setting up a home network, the most essential piece of equipment is the router. The way that most home networks are set-up is to have a router as the only device connected to the internet. Learning to configure your router is an important step towards customizing your home network.
How To Find Your Wise Routers IP Address
In order to login to your router, you need to know it's Internal IP Address. This is confusing because routers have 2 IP addresses: an Internal IP Address, and an External IP Address. Right now, you are only concerned with the Internal IP Address. You can do one of the following to find your router's Internal IP Address:
